WebIf you’d like to cultivate several different types of berry plants, a cranberry bush makes a great companion for blueberries since they have similar growing requirements. Depending on the variety, cranberries grow in USDA zones 4-7. Like blueberries, there are highbush and lowbush cranberry cultivars. Blueberry thrives in acidic soil, with a pH ranging from 4.3 to 5.5. So, companion plants for Blueberry should be able to flourish and adapt to these conditions. WebJan 30, 2024 · 1. Blueberries. Blueberry bushes are one of the best choices for companion planting with blackberries. Blueberries mainly benefit blackberry plants by attracting pollinators and beneficial insects (ladybugs, beneficial wasps, and the like). Since blackberries are a bramble and blueberries are a bush, they don’t compete. WebFeb 19, 2024 · Azalea are ideal companion plants for blueberries because they enjoy similar conditions to thrive. Fern; 1.10 10. … WebAug 13, 2024 · Many companion plants do a great job of repelling these insects from your blueberry bushes. Some include marigolds, nasturtiums, catnip, basil, thyme, rosemary, marjoram, and rue. Hardiness Zones: 3-7 or 7-9 depending on the variety. Soil: Heavy clay, loam, sandy, PH between 4 to 4.8, well-drained, fertile, rich in organic matter. Sun Exposure: Full sun. Planting: Early in spring. Spacing: 4 to 5 feet between plants and 8 to 9 feet between rows.
